General objective
The Financial and Banking Management Diploma Program aims to:
1 - Qualifying students with high school diplomas in the field of financial management.
2 - Developing the skills of employees of ministries, agencies, and governmental and private institutions working in financial departments and qualifying them scientifically and practically, which increases their abilities to perform their work efficiently and competently.
3- Providing national human resources in the field of financial and banking management.
4- Promoting business ethics and social responsibility in public and private business organizations.
5- Achieving performance and competitiveness in the field of financial and banking management.

 Job opportunities for graduates
The program aims to provide the graduate with scientific and practical knowledge in the field of financial and banking management to meet the needs of the labor market for national cadres. The graduate’s fields of work are represented in: banks, brokerage companies and brokers, financial departments, statistics and planning, financial control bodies and accounting offices, financial consulting offices, personal finance. Financial and accounting sectors, administrative and financial departments, corporate finance, government funds.
